Ca' Foscari University of Venice is a premier public university located in the heart of Venice, Italy. Founded in 1868, it is renowned for its strong focus on humanities, economics, languages, and sciences, all studied within the unique and inspiring context of a city that is a UNESCO World Heritage site.

While its iconic headquarters are in the historic center, Ca' Foscari also has modern campuses and facilities in the mainland district of Mestre, which houses many scientific departments and offers a different, more contemporary campus experience.
The Housing Office provides a free online portal with verified listings, offers personalized support in searching for rooms/apartments, helps with understanding rental contracts, and reserves a number of beds in partnered student residences.
The cost can vary widely, but students should expect to pay between €400 and €600 per month for a single room in a shared apartment. Prices are generally higher in the historic center and lower in the Mestre mainland area.
